Enaruna: Jayhawks expect injured Wilson to bounce back

By Staff     Nov 9, 2019

Kansas freshman wing Tristan Enaruna shared after the Jayhawks’ victory over UNC Greensboro that teammates expect injured Jalen Wilson to bounce back.

“We never want things like this to happen,” Enaruna said after Wilson broke his left ankle in the KU win, “but he’s strong mentally and he’s positive so he’ll come back strongly.”

Enaruna also explained what worked well for him, Isaiah Moss and KU’s four-guard lineups.
